About Franceska Zampeli

Franceska Zampeli is a scholar working on Orthopedics and Sports Medicine, Surgery and Biomedical Engineering, having authored 18 papers that have together received 425 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Knee injuries and reconstruction techniques (16 papers), Total Knee Arthroplasty Outcomes (11 papers) and Sports injuries and prevention (10 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Orthopedics and Sports Medicine (294 citations), Surgery (373 citations) and Biomedical Engineering (152 citations). Franceska Zampeli has collaborated with scholars based in Greece, United States and Australia. Frequent co-authors include Anastasios D. Georgoulis, Evangelos Pappas, Sofia A. Xergia, Stavros Ristanis, G. Mitsionis, Aikaterini Ntoulia, Nikolaos K. Paschos, Nicholas Stergiou, Maria I. Argyropoulou and Constantina Moraiti. Their work appears in journals such as The American Journal of Sports Medicine, Arthroscopy The Journal of Arthroscopic and Related Surgery and Journal of Orthopaedic and Sports Physical Therapy.
